Which is to say, fans who played the first game are in for a treat, with a number of returning characters from their first jaunt through Guerrilla Games' massive robot-filled open-world making appearances again in Forbidden West. To what narrative length is yet to remain seen, but it's good know your impact on the story the first time around, will be reverberated in the sequel.


Not that the first Horizon outing featured much in the way of storyline-defining decision making, but everyone loves a bit of narrative carryover.
In the next chapter of Aloy’s story she’ll face a storm of new threats: a world-ending blight, Regalla and her rebels, Sylens and his machinations, but as she ventures into the frontier of the Forbidden West, she won’t face these perils alone. Aloy will be joined by companions both fresh and familiar, including stalwarts like Varl and Erend, along with new allies like Zo, Alva and Kotallo.
Alongside the new story trailer embedded above, have a squiz at some new art shared over at the PlayStation Blog.

Horizon Forbidden West is out exclusively for PS5 this February 18.
